CVE-2025-0373 Buffer overflow in some filesystems via NFS

On 64-bit systems, the implementation of VOPVPTOFH in the cd9660, tarfs and ext2fs filesystems overflows the destination FID buffer by 4 bytes, a stack buffer overflow.
